Hue Pairing Advice for Elegant Outfits
Effective color coordination can enhance any outfit, as it allows people to express their unique style while creating a harmonious appearance. To achieve this, one should begin by understanding the color wheel, identifying colors that complement each other that boost each other. For instance, pairing warm hues like reds and oranges with cool colors such as blues and greens can create bold contrasts.
Neutral colors, such as black, white, and beige, serve as flexible foundations that can ground bolder tones. Additionally, incorporating varying shades of the same color—known as monochromatic styling—can build complexity without overwhelming the look.
Applying the 60-30-10 rule, in which 60% of the outfit represents a primary tone, 30% a secondary hue, and 10% an accent, can also ensure balanced color distribution. Ultimately, exploring various color mixes will help develop one's unique style while sustaining a elegant look.
Layering Prints and Surfaces for Visual Impact
Combining designs and materials can transform an ordinary outfit into an captivating ensemble. To create a visually appealing look, one must take into account equilibrium and coordination. Matching bold patterns, such as stripes or florals, with quieter materials can produce distinction without overpowering the eye. For example, a floral blouse can be elegantly enhanced by a patterned jean jacket, adding depth to the outfit.
Adding multiple materials, including knits, silks, or leathers, enhances the general appearance. When mixing patterns, it is advisable to follow a consistent color palette to sustain consistency. A polka dot skirt, to demonstrate, can work well with a striped top if both feature a shared color.
Additionally, modifying the size of designs—mixing large prints with petite designs—can offer aesthetic appeal and prevent clashing. Ultimately, the secret lies in trial and error, enabling personal style to come across while creating enchanting combinations.
Perfecting Layering Garments for a Elegant Look
Layering can enhance any outfit, developing it into a polished statement. The key to successful layering lies in balancing proportions and textures. Start with a fitted base layer, such as a simple tank or turtleneck, which serves as a starting point. Next, incorporate a slightly looser mid-layer, like a button-up shirt or lightweight sweater, to add dimension without bulk.
Outer layers like crisp blazers or voluminous cardigans can perfect the style while providing thermal comfort and refinement. Pick harmonious colors and prints to create visual appeal, guaranteeing that each layer augments rather than conflicts with the others.
Accessories, including a stylish scarf or a statement jacket, can further define the layered ensemble. Ultimately, the art of layering transforms standard garments into a cohesive, polished outfit, allowing the wearer to express personal style effortlessly.

Versatile Bag Varieties
Bags are able to effortlessly enhance any outfit, acting both practical and decorative purposes. A smartly picked bag not only complements a look but also improves functionality. Versatile options such as traditional totes, crossbody bags, and structured satchels fit to various occasions. Totes are best for daily errands, offering enough space without sacrificing style. Crossbody bags evaluation give a hands free option, great for relaxed outings or travel. Structured satchels add a polished touch to work attire, making them suitable for formal environments. Additionally, adding neutral colors can guarantee that these bags effortlessly integrate with several outfits. By selecting the ideal bag, individuals can effortlessly shift from day to night, showcasing a well-curated sense of style while maintaining practicality.
